Russia has withdrawn two missile boats from Sevastopol

The Russian Black Sea Fleet continues to depart from the occupied Sevastopol. This was reported by the Telegram channel Crimean Wind.

"Our eyes" see everything: the Russian Black Sea Fleet continues to leave Sevastopol," the message reads.

It is noted that two missile boats of project 1241 Lightning-1 sailed along the southern coast of Crimea heading east accompanied by a convoy of two high-speed boats.

As reported, on the night of February 1, 2024, fighters of the special forces unit Group 13 of the Main Intelligence Directorate of the Ministry of Defense of Ukraine destroyed the missile boat Ivanovets - project 1241 Lightning-1.

Only two boats of this project remain in the Black Sea Fleet - R-60 and Naberezhnye Chelny.
